WebSep 27, 2024 · Most California gasoline in recent years has contained MTBE, even though there has never been any legal requirement for its use. In March 1999, Governor Gray Davis issued the first of two executive orders directing the elimination of this widely used fuel additive from California gasoline. This fact sheet contains information about the … WebMTBE has occurred due to leaks from underground and above ground petroleum storage tank systems and pipelines. Due to its small molecular size and solubility in water, MTBE moves rapidly into groundwater, faster than do other constituents of gasoline. MTBE, however, degrades much more slowly in groundwater than other components of gasoline.

Maximum Contaminant Level ( MCL) - The highest level of a contaminant that is allowed in drinking water. MCLs are set as close to MCLGs as feasible using the best available treatment technology and taking cost into consideration.
